Aminophylline is a competitive phosphodiesterase 3/4 (PDE3/4) inhibitor. Aminophylline also acts as an adenosine receptor antagonist. Aminophylline elevates intracellular cAMP levels via competitive inhibition of PDE3 and PDE4, antagonizes adenosine A1 receptor (ADORA1), regulates intracellular calcium signaling and synaptic vesicle cycling, upregulates the PPAR signaling pathway, and downregulates glutamatergic synaptic pathways simultaneously. Aminophylline can be used in research related to major depressive disorder, epilepsy, and chronic obstructive pulmonary disease (COPD) .

7-Chlorokynurenic acid (7-CKA) is a potent and selective antagonist of the glycine B coagonist site of the N-methyl-D-aspartate (NMDA) receptor (IC50=0.56 μM). 7-Chlorokynurenic acid is also a potent inhibitor of the reuptake of glutamate into synaptic vesicles with a Ki of 0.59 μM. 7-Chlorokynurenic acid has potent antinociceptive actions after neuraxial delivery .

Levetiracetam, an antiepileptic agent, binds the synaptic vesicle protein SV2A. Levetiracetam enhances Temozolomide effect on glioblastoma stem cell proliferation and apoptosis. Levetiracetam modulates HDAC levels ultimately silencing MGMT, thus increasing Temozolomide effectiveness. A chemosensitizer agent .

Tetrabenazine (Ro 1-9569) is a brain-penetrant and orally active VMAT2-selective ligand with human VMAT2 Ki 100 nM. Tetrabenazine binds VMAT2 to block monoamine uptake into synaptic vesicles, potentiates cytoplasmic monoamine degradation. Tetrabenazine weakly blocks dopamine D2 receptors, and increases dopamine turnover via elevated cerebrospinal fluid homovanillic acid. Tetrabenazine can be used for the research of Huntington’s disease, tardive dyskinesia, and Tourette’s syndrome .

Lobeline (α-Lobeline) hydrochloride is a brain-penetrant nicotinic receptor agonist. Lobeline hydrochloride increases dopamine (DA) release by inhibiting DA uptake into synaptic vesicles, and altering presynaptic DA storage. Lobeline hydrochloride is effective in smoking cessation .

(-)-Vesamicol (AH5183) is a vesicular acetylcholine transporter inhibitor. (-)-Vesamicol reversibly and non-competitively inhibits the transport of acetylcholine into circulating synaptic vesicles and blocks the activity of vesicular acetylcholine transporters in medial amygdala neurons. (-)-Vesamicol is applicable to research related to central precocious puberty .

α-Latrotoxin, a potent neurotoxin from black widow spider venom, triggers synaptic vesicle exocytosis from presynaptic nerve terminals .

Neocarzilin A (NCA) reduces BST-2 levels via lysosomal degradation. Neocarzilin A has antimigratory and antiproliferative effects on cancer cells. Neocarzilin A inhibits cancer cell migration via irreversible binding to the synaptic vesicle membrane protein VAT-1 .

FM1-84 (Neurodye GH1-84) is a fluorescent dye. FM1-84 has lipophilic and facilitates association with membranes, resulting in an increase in fluorescence intensity (λex=510 nm, λem=625 nm). FM1-84 can be used for synaptic vesicle recycling in neurons research .

UCB-J is a ligand for synaptic vesicle protein 2A (SV2A) with pIC50 values for human and rat SV2A of 8.15 and 7.6 respectively. UCB-J can be used to display and quantify the total synaptic density throughout the brain .
